示例#1
0
    public void SendCustomMetric()
    {
        EventHitBuilder builder = GetEventHitBuilder();

        float averageScore = SaveManager.GetTotalScore() / SaveManager.GetTotalPlay();

        builder.SetCustomMetric(metricDict["Total Play"], SaveManager.GetTotalPlay().ToString());
        builder.SetCustomMetric(metricDict["Best Score"], SaveManager.GetMaxScore().ToString());
        builder.SetCustomMetric(metricDict["Avg Score"], ((int)averageScore).ToString());
        builder.SetCustomMetric(metricDict["Total Exp"], Saved.GetInt(SaveKey.PlayerExp).ToString());
        builder.SetCustomDimension(dimensionDict["Total Chartboost"], PlayerPrefs.GetInt("Play Chartboost Ads", 0).ToString());
        builder.SetCustomDimension(dimensionDict["Total Unityads"], PlayerPrefs.GetInt("Play Unity Ads", 0).ToString());
        builder.SetCustomDimension(dimensionDict["Total Admob"], PlayerPrefs.GetInt("Play Admob Ads", 0).ToString());
        builder.SetCustomMetric(metricDict["Mission Completed"], "0");
        builder.SetEventCategory("Event");
        builder.SetEventAction("Attend");
        builder.SetEventLabel("attend");
        builder.SetEventValue(1);
    }
示例#2
0
    void Awake()
    {
        //	/*
        mRemoveAds  = Saved.GetBool(SaveKey.RemoveAds);
        mStartTut   = Saved.GetBool(SaveKey.StartTutorial);
        mGameTut    = Saved.GetBool(SaveKey.GameTutorial);
        mMissionTut = Saved.GetBool(SaveKey.MissionTutorial);
        mFeverTut   = Saved.GetBool(SaveKey.FeverTutorial);


        mPlayerExp  = Saved.GetInt(SaveKey.PlayerExp);
        mMaxScore   = Saved.GetInt(SaveKey.MaxScore);
        mTotalScore = Saved.GetInt(SaveKey.TotalScore);
        mTotalPlay  = Saved.GetInt(SaveKey.TotalPlay);

        mMaxCombo          = Saved.GetInt(SaveKey.MaxCombo);
        mTotalReceipt      = Saved.GetInt(SaveKey.TotalReceipt);
        mMaxChange         = Saved.GetInt(SaveKey.MaxChange);
        mMaxFeverSuccess   = Saved.GetInt(SaveKey.MaxFeverSuccess);
        mSound             = Saved.GetBool(SaveKey.Sound);
        mDisPlayCount      = Saved.GetInt(SaveKey.DisPlayCount);
        mTotalDissatisfied = Saved.GetInt(SaveKey.TotalDissatisfied);
        mGirl = Saved.GetInt(SaveKey.GirlMission);

        mBald = Saved.GetInt(SaveKey.BaldMission);
        mBaldLastPlayedTime = Saved.GetString(SaveKey.BaldLastPlayedTime);
        mBaldPlayingTime    = Saved.GetFloat(SaveKey.BaldPlayingTime);

        GetCollectionInfo();

        mIgnorant = Saved.GetInt(SaveKey.IgnorantMission);
        mHomeless = Saved.GetInt(SaveKey.HomelessMission);
        mThief    = Saved.GetInt(SaveKey.ThiefMission);
        mSkeptic  = Saved.GetInt(SaveKey.SkepticMission);
//	*/
        //	ObscuredPrefs.DeleteAll();
    }